On Thu, Jan 24, 2002 at 02:16:07PM -0700, Richard Kandarian wrote:
>The path to MSVC is set in the registry (i.e. Control panel > system > 
>advanced > environment (or however you get there)). To be even more precise 
>tcsh inherits the environment from bash which inherits it from cmd.exe 
>which gets it from the registry somehow.
>
>Sorry I didn't mention that.
>
>If I execute 'tcsh -l' at a cmd.exe prompt the behavior is the same. (I 
>didn't know I could do that! I thought I needed bash to read /etc/profile 
>to get everything setup.)

It still sounds like you have something like a "set path=($PATH)" somewhere.

For the record, there were very few changes made between 1.3.8 and 1.3.9
and none of the changes had anything to do with environment handlin.
